Pollutants Transformation During the Regeneration Process of Fluid Catalytic Cracking Catalysts
Fluid catalytic cracking is the main pollutant source in crude oil refineries due to spent catalyst regeneration. In this work, flue gas pollutants are monitored and coke deposits are identified. Operando and in situ spectroscopy are developed to explore coke species evolution, coupled with online gas infrared spectroscopy to detect pollutant formation.

Dioxins and PCBs in Meat – Still a Matter of Concern?
Polychlorinated dibenzodioxins (PCDDs) and polychlorinated dibenzofurans (PCDFs) summarized as dioxins, as well as polychlorinated biphenyls (PCBs) are persistent, bio-accumulative and toxic environmental contaminants. Over 95% of human exposure

Update of the risk assessment on dioxins and dioxin‐like PCBs in feed and food
Abstract The European Commission asked EFSA to update its 2018 risk assessment on polychlorinated dibenzo‐p‐dioxins and dibenzofurans (PCDD/Fs) and dioxin‐like polychlorinated biphenyls (DL‐PCBs) in feed and food, based on the 2022 WHO Toxic Equivalency Factors (WHO2022‐TEFs).
